Titans Show Confidence in Rookie QB Cam Ward Despite Early Accuracy Concerns
Tennessee Titans coaches are expressing confidence in rookie quarterback Cam Ward even as the young passer works through some accuracy issues during offseason workouts. Observers have noted that Ward, selected in the 2026 NFL Draft, has struggled at times with precision on throws throughout the team's organized team activities (OTAs) in recent weeks. Despite these challenges, the Titans' staff remains optimistic about Ward’s trajectory and ability to adapt to the professional level.
During the early portion of OTAs, Ward’s completion percentage in drills has fluctuated, drawing some attention from those tracking his progress. Accuracy is a known area for development as Ward transitions from college to the NFL, where the speed of the game and tighter windows test even the most talented prospects. Yet team officials are not alarmed by these growing pains, viewing them as part of the standard adjustment period for a rookie quarterback.
- Ward has participated in all scheduled OTA sessions since joining the Titans after the draft.
- The coaching staff has noted improvements in Ward’s decision-making and command of the playbook, despite some errant passes.
- Accuracy issues have been most noticeable during competitive drills against the first-team defense.
According to reports from the team’s sessions, the Titans have continued to give Ward significant reps with both starting and reserve units. This approach is designed to accelerate his learning curve and expose him to different defensive looks. Coaches believe that increased familiarity with the team's system and tempo will help the rookie settle in and improve his consistency.
While some fans and analysts have raised concerns about Ward’s accuracy based on OTA observations, the Titans maintain that these practices are primarily for learning and do not necessarily predict regular season performance. The coaching staff's confidence signals that Ward remains firmly in the team’s long-term development plans, and they are prepared to be patient as he acclimates to the NFL’s demands.
